Sightseeing in Madhya Pradesh

There are many interesting places to see in Madhya Pradesh.

Bhopal was founded in the 11th century and was the capital of the Parmar. But what you get to see in Bhopal today for the most part dates back only to the 18th century. As far as sightseeing goes, it is an interesting city, a mixture of the traditional and contemporary that sprawls across hills and lakes. The old city, with its crowded markets, narrow alleys, beautiful palaces, old havelis (manors) and fine mosques, lies juxtaposed with the well-planned new city of broad avenues, modern buildings and well planned residential colonies.

On a hill, a few miles from Bhopal stands the prettiest and the oldest stupa in the world, the famous Sanchi stupa, ringed by a stone fence with exquisite toranas at its four gates. The stupas and ruins at Sanchi are places to visit as they tell the tale of the spread of Buddhism across the plains of Central India.

Gwalior was for long the seat of the powerful Maratha kings, the Scindias. The Scindia family is still very much in the thick of political things, having the made the transition from rulers of the kingdom to contestants and winners of general elections. Their influence over the city continues to be strong. Take a sightseeing tour to this city with a strong cultural heritage and some of the finest exponents of Indian classical music claiming it as home. The Gwalior Fort is the city's chief attraction.

Travellers come from far and wide to see the world famous temples of Khajuraho. The temples are unique in architecture and stunning in their ornamentation, making Khajuraho a great place to see. The temples are all there is to see, but you don’t need much more than these magnificent monuments to the gods, as you try and absorb the breadth of man’s artistic ability and aesthetic vision that breathe life into mere slabs of stone.

Most people visiting the state head for Khajuraho to explore the thousand-year old temples whose outstanding architecture and ornamentation have made them a World Heritage Site.

However, Madhya Pradesh has a lot more to offer. It has the world’s largest cluster of stone-age rock shelters and cave paintings at Bhimbetka; the imposing forts of Gwalior and Indore, replete with romantic tales of valour and chivalry; the 16th and 17th century Bundela palaces and temples at Orchcha and ethereal Mandu, the historic capital of the Malwa Sultans, now all but a ghost town.

Hindu pilgrims travel from far and wide to pay obeisance at Ujjain. The holy city takes on a colorful festive ambience when thousands of devout Hindus arrive for a ritual dip in the river on the occasion of Simhastha (full moon to full moon of the Indian lunar months of Chaitra and Vaisakha, around April/May). Other places to visit in Madhya Pradesh are Maheshwar, Indore, Orchcha and Omkareshwar, which abound in temples and bathing ghats.

If you are looking for rest and relaxation you could head south to the cool and tranquil environs of Pachmarhi, the highest hill station in the state (alt. 1067m). Bhedaghat is a spectacular waterfall near Jabalpur, where the water cascades over cliffs of white marble. Marble Rocks, as it is commonly called, is an interesting stopover enroute to the nearby wildlife parks at Kanha or Bandhavgarh.
